CCSD High Schools Earn State Recognition for AP Programs

For the ninth year in a row, all CCSD traditional high schools were named Georgia AP Honor Schools for commendable student performance and participation on AP exams. As a district, CCSD ranks fifth overall in Georgia for AP exam pass rates.
 
AP courses and exams are administered by the College Board, which also administers the SAT. Students who receive a 3, 4, or 5 on AP exams are often eligible to receive college credit, reducing the cost of earning a college degree.
 
CCSD high schools earned recognition in all four categories for which its schools were eligible. All CCSD high schools continued their presence on the AP STEM Schools and AP STEM Achievement Schools lists, five were named AP Humanities Schools (Creekview, Etowah, River Ridge, Sequoyah, and Woodstock), and two schools won a place on the Merit School list (Creekview and Etowah).
